Chris Stuckmann reviews Abigail, starring Melissa Barrera, Dan Stevens, Alisha Weir, Kathryn Newton, Kevin Durand, Angus Cloud, William Catlett, Giancarlo Esposito. Directed by Matt Bettinelli-Olpin, Tyler Gillett.
